Cameron Road is in Wirral and in Wirral district. CH46 1PJ is located in the Leasowe and Moreton East elect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Wallasey. This postcode has been in use since 1999-06-01.

Is Cameron Road dangerous?

In 2023, 389 crimes were reported near Cameron Road . Only 27%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ered not saf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of CH46 1PJ.
